Has Houllier lost the dressing room?

    There have been many signs in the last month or so that Houllier has lost the support of the team.the players have taken to speaking publicly about the clubs seasons of failure and its a sign that things are not well at Anfield.GH was always a man for mentioning individual players when they played poorly . but his recent post-match comments have consisted of nothing but 'the boys stuck together etc etc '.
    It looks like the end is in sight and GH seems to take defeats/draws and turn them into moral victorys.His joviality after some recent (poor)matches shows signs to me that he and the players know something we dont.
    Added to that the strong rumours regarding O'Neill's future at Celtic and I cant help but see a change in the summer.GH has not been the same since his health scare and probably knows he can take the team no further,surely the overly supportive Liverpool board will call time on his reign and let the man retire in the summer with his dignity attached.
